Output aa1576456f7ea084cdfd0e15611c5d0b9afb3c3dac340f9b797a15f3d19b95c7:0

value
180598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 215c0ed8f1c8b92703b6fb1cc113aa6ed69b60ef OP_EQUAL
address
34jQWBAFWEWh1BTpTyQQLa4phuUpgn5vfw
transaction
aa1576456f7ea084cdfd0e15611c5d0b9afb3c3dac340f9b797a15f3d19b95c7